Jonathan Giles
|
780ee7a2a8
|
Fix build error and logic ...
|
2 years ago |
dragonmux
|
cf204448bf
|
misc: Fixed the push and pull_request branch requirements for our CI to run
|
2 years ago |
dragonmux
|
d78f7696cc
|
stm32/serialno: Run clang-format on the serial number code
|
2 years ago |
dragonmux
|
fef40b701f
|
stm32/serialno: Fixed a typo in the 24 character serial number loop
before: 0670FF530000000000000000
after: 0670FF535567494867085055
|
2 years ago |
Manoel Brunnen
|
d140b4b667
|
stlink: Fix the LED pinout on the Nucleo boards
|
6 years ago |
Rafael Silva
|
1a963b81f6
|
target/stm32f1: GD32E230 option write special case handling
Signed-off-by: Rafael Silva <perigoso@riseup.net>
|
2 years ago |
Rafael Silva
|
e7a7d82b33
|
target/stm32f1: remove unused code snippet and superfluous preprocessor check, less pedantic wording on warning
Signed-off-by: Rafael Silva <perigoso@riseup.net>
|
2 years ago |
Rafael Silva
|
a5ebff14bb
|
target/stm32f1: remove redundant grouping ad for loop cleanup
Signed-off-by: Rafael Silva <perigoso@riseup.net>
|
2 years ago |
Rafael Silva
|
90ed4fe31a
|
target/stm32f1: clang-format and code styling for better readability
Signed-off-by: Rafael Silva <perigoso@riseup.net>
|
2 years ago |
Rafael Silva
|
5666fa2a2f
|
target/sam3x: add aditional check for valid EEFC addr
Signed-off-by: Rafael Silva <rafaelsilva@ajtec.pt>
|
2 years ago |
Rafael Silva
|
1bca0323d9
|
target/sam3x: saner uninitialized variable prevention
Signed-off-by: Rafael Silva <perigoso@riseup.net>
|
2 years ago |
dragonmux
|
2ef4269b0e
|
misc: Added recomendations for VSCode extensions to be used with the project
This has been done so that clang-tidy and clang-format can be better enforced
|
2 years ago |
dragonmux
|
3a02fdea9d
|
misc: Added a clang-tidy Makefile target so enforcing the formatting is easier
|
2 years ago |
dragonmux
|
0e184c7b98
|
misc: Cleaned up the clang-format configuration ready for it to be applied
|
2 years ago |
dragonmux
|
30a7e9f0d4
|
misc: Added a clang-tidy Makefile target so we can run `make clang-tidy` now
|
2 years ago |
dragonmux
|
215b935b83
|
scripts: Created a clang-tidy runner to allow quick and easy running of clang-tidy across the code base
|
2 years ago |
dragonmux
|
4339a131e8
|
misc: Written a basic clang-tidy configuration
|
2 years ago |
Jonathan Giles
|
730a795f09
|
Add idcode for GD32F303CG detection
|
3 years ago |
dragonmux
|
09f64b0627
|
misc: Added a HACKING.md to provide an explanation of nomenclature and how we handle reset terminology
|
2 years ago |
dragonmux
|
c33d02bc19
|
hosted/stlink: Improved the information output and its consistency
|
2 years ago |
dragonmux
|
aa9c80b37d
|
misc: Formatting consistency
|
2 years ago |
dragonmux
|
2765811bbb
|
hosted/stlink: Naming consistency for 'stlink' global object
|
2 years ago |
dragonmux
|
66b2d0659a
|
hosted: type naming consistency
|
2 years ago |
dragonmux
|
baf84c9eb4
|
launchpad-icdi: Cleaned up and fixed some C89-isms
|
2 years ago |
dragonmux
|
0139a349ab
|
hosted/FTDI: Cleaned up the error handling so the compiler can usefully tell us of errors in conditions
This also fixes an accidental assignment bug in libfti_max_frequency_set()
|
2 years ago |
dragonmux
|
826840bf90
|
hosted/remote: Cleaned up the error handling so the compiler can usefully tell us of errors in conditions
|
2 years ago |
dragonmux
|
fbe804f905
|
hosted/ftdi: Updated the 'cables' definitions
|
2 years ago |
dragonmux
|
5ec848e948
|
hosted/jlink: Fixed use of 'int' where 'size_t' is more appropriate
|
2 years ago |
dragonmux
|
9b53fbf6ea
|
launchpad-icdi: Fixed up and rewritten the serial number code to match what was done in #1041
|
2 years ago |
dragonmux
|
c271c5c979
|
remote: Updated the naming in the remote protocol macros
|
2 years ago |
dragonmux
|
adc03e47d6
|
hosted: Cleaned up and fixed the definitions of the fill functions for HOSTED_BMP_ONLY
|
2 years ago |
dragonmux
|
94afb264e4
|
command: Cleaned up and improved the naming of cmd_reset and cmd_connect_reset
|
2 years ago |
dragonmux
|
12fefa73c9
|
platforms: Cleaned up and fixed many markdown lint errors, improving the formatting of many of the platform README's
|
2 years ago |
dragonmux
|
0dae6a4019
|
misc: Renamed connect_assert_nrst to clarify usage and align naming
|
2 years ago |
dragonmux
|
b226c53d13
|
misc: Renamed CORTEXM_TOPT_INHIBIT_NRST to clarify usage and align naming
|
2 years ago |
dragonmux
|
5edf549b48
|
misc: Updated comments and READMEs to properly reflect pinouts and function
|
2 years ago |
dragonmux
|
2eaa579965
|
platforms: NRST and TRST naming consistency
This aligns the nRST and nTRST pin naming with the bulk of the README's for the platforms along with the hardware
|
2 years ago |
dragonmux
|
a8e12d716d
|
misc: Renamed platform_nrst_{get,set}_val to clarify naming and provide consistency
|
2 years ago |
dragonmux
|
dbb7a81c0a
|
misc: Added a code of conduct based on the Contributors Covenant
|
2 years ago |
SId Price
|
bc9032da06
|
Fix uninitialized variables in target sam3x
Exposed while building hosted with -Og option
|
2 years ago |
dragonmux
|
0612f2dc79
|
hosted: Documented the new command line option and added it to the ZSH completions
|
2 years ago |
dragonmux
|
52dcf46e61
|
command: Done a little cleanup of the formatting and layout
|
2 years ago |
dragonmux
|
10a4c3f77e
|
hosted: Implemented the extra logic to implement auto-scan in the CLI
|
2 years ago |
dragonmux
|
2aea7238af
|
command: Implemented the new 'auto_scan' command for the firmware
|
2 years ago |
dragonmux
|
ce3544b206
|
hosted: Removed unwanted automatic switch over to JTAG when SWD scan fails
|
2 years ago |
dragonmux
|
b713376ce7
|
hosted/cmsis_dap: Fixed the naming of the cmsis_type_e enum
|
2 years ago |
dragonmux
|
07321a4114
|
ch32f1: Fixed another broken debug print that made assumptions about %x and %d that are wrong
|
2 years ago |
dragonmux
|
680a009690
|
cortexm: Added additional debug information for part probing
|
2 years ago |
dragonmux
|
b5b2d4dc95
|
ch32f1: Re-ordered a couple of the operation in ch32f1_probe so it plays nicer with the STM32 parts
|
2 years ago |
dragonmux
|
0368b76078
|
ch32f1: Further formatting and layout cleanup
|
2 years ago |